Removing Programs from Control Panel’s Add/Remove

If you uninstalled a program by deleting the files, it may still show up in the Add/Remove programs list in the Control Panel.


In order to remove it from the list :
1.Open Registry Editor (Go to Start Menu -> Run, and then type regedit and press enter)

2.Go to H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E \ SOFTWARE \ Microsoft \ Windows \ CurrentVersion \ Uninstall

3.Delete any programs here. Then it will be removed from the Control Panel’s Add/Remove

Note: If you have a problem locating the desired program, open each key and view the DisplayName value
